About Alexander Schachtel
Alexander Schachtel is a highly skilled litigation generalist with significant experience in handling a diverse range of civil actions in both state and federal courts across New York and New Jersey. Raised in northern New Jersey, Alexander draws on the rich legal heritage of his family to provide exceptional service to his clients. He is a graduate of Duke University and Seton Hall Law School, where he laid the foundation for his legal career. His early training at a leading regional law firm, followed by his tenure as an associate at one of the largest firms in the United States, equipped him with invaluable expertise.
In pursuit of delivering personalized legal services, Alexander established his own practice nearly eight years ago. His dedication and commitment to justice have led to numerous successes for his clients across various legal domains. Alexander is admitted to practice law in both New York and New Jersey, and is authorized to appear before the Federal District Court for the District of New Jersey, the New Jersey Bankruptcy Court, and the Federal District Courts for the Southern and Eastern Districts of New York.
His professional achievements have been recognized with the designation of a “Super Lawyer” in New Jersey from 2020 to 2022. Additionally, he secured one of the top 50 civil verdicts by monetary value in New Jersey in 2019.

New Jersey Car Accident Laws
Understanding New Jersey's accident laws is critical when pursuing a claim. Here are the key legal rules that apply to your case:
Statute of Limitations
2 years
Time limit to file a claim
Negligence Rule
modified comparative fault (51%)
How fault is determined
Min. Insurance (BI/PD)
$15K/$30K/$5K
Per person/per accident/property
Insurance System
No-Fault
Your own insurance covers injuries
